Course details

• Understanding Team Leadership: An Introduction
• The Role of a Team Leader or Supervisor in Sales
• Effective Communication and Interpersonal Skills for Sales Team Leaders
• Setting Sales Targets and Performance Measures
• Motivating and Developing Sales Teams
• Time Management and Prioritization for Sales Team Leaders
• Conflict Resolution and Problem-Solving in Sales Teams
• Sales Reporting and Analysis for Team Leaders
• Leveraging Technology for Sales Team Management
• Career Development and Advancement for Sales Team Leaders

First, let's explore the Sales Team Leader role. A Sales Team Leader guides and motivates a team of sales professionals, ensuring that they achieve their targets and contribute to the organization's overall success. As depicted in the chart, Sales Team Leaders constitute 45% of sales roles in the industry, highlighting the significance of their contribution. Next, the Sales Supervisor role is responsible for monitoring sales team performance, training new sales representatives, and driving sales strategies. According to the chart, Sales Supervisors account for 35% of sales roles, further underlining their importance in the industry. Additionally, there are other roles related to sales team leadership and supervision. For instance, the Assistant Sales Team Leader supports the Sales Team Leader in managing the team and overseeing daily operations. This role comprises 10% of sales positions in the industry. Lastly, Junior Sales Supervisors, with 10% of sales roles, collaborate with the Sales Supervisor to manage sales teams and analyze sales data to optimize performance.
